SPECIALIST – SYSTEM DEVELOPMENT (IT 2304032)
This position will be based at Martabe Site in the IT and Systems Department, and reports directly to Superintendent – Information System.
The role of the Specialist – System Development will be responsible for overseeing a team of system developers (internal and external) and managing projects related to the design, development, and maintenance of complex systems and applications that support the business needs of our organization. You will work closely with cross-functional teams, including software developers, system architects, network engineers, and project managers, to ensure that project goals are achieved on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ards.
Qualification
- Minimum Bachelor’s degree in Information System / Information Technology / Computer Science or relevant experiences.
- Minimum of 5 years in full SDLC experiences.
- Good command of English (written and spoken).
- Able to design/manage enterprise systems and analyse business process requirements.
- Strong programming skills in one or more programming languages (Java, Python, JSON, etc.)
- Practical knowledge of codeless programming platforms (Microsoft Power Platform or similar platform).
- Solid understanding of software development best practices, such as agile development, code reviews, version control, security review and testing.
- Familiarity with cloud platforms (Microsoft Azure, AWS, etc.).
- Experience in project management roles and methodologies, such as Agile, Scrum, or Waterfall.
- Solid knowledge of IT infrastructure (servers, network, security, etc.) to support system development.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ills, with the ability to identify and mitigate project risks and issues.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
- Hard Worker, Team Player, Orientation to detail & ability to handle multiple projects with tight deadlines.
